Flamin' Hot duo Annie Gonzalez and Jesse Garcia have discussed the appeal of the popular puff snack Cheetos.
In first-time director Eva Longoria's upcoming comedy-drama biopic, Gonzalez and Garcia portray married couple Judy and Richard Montañez – the latter being the janitor who originally claimed to have invented Flamin' Hot Cheetos in the early '90s, a spicier version of the Frito-Lay product.
Catching up with Digital Spy for an exclusive chat ahead of the movie's release, the two cast members salivated over that perfect Cheetos crunch.

"Oh my gosh, it's like the texture of a fresh bag, coupled with the flavour when you get a fresh bag – the crunch," began Gonzalez.
"It's delicious. And then it gets a little moist in your mouth. It's amazing. It's all the things that you want in a snack."
Garcia, whose other credits include Narcos: Mexico and Sons of Anarchy, added: "I think sometimes it's, like, the heat is existing.
"It's not going to overwhelm you if you keep eating. You know, as soon as you stop eating something hot, there's like hot hot, but if you keep eating it, it's not as hot."
Gonzalez added: "Yeah, and I feel like the Hot Cheeto itself – it's not super, super hot. You know?"

Back when the project was first announced, Longoria herself teased a unique underdog story.
"I think probably the greatest challenge was making sure we stayed true to the theme of the movie, which is opportunity is not distributed equally," she told Variety.
"And when that happens, you have to work twice as hard and twice as long and be twice as good. And you still have to persevere and the story is so many things. It's rags to riches, it's American Dream 101, it's about perseverance, it's about the underdog.
"But at the end of the day, it's also about one person's perspective and struggle within themselves. So it's a beautiful, beautiful biopic."
Flamin' Hot is released on Disney+ in the UK and on Hulu in the US on June 9.
